David Curl
About David Curl
David Curl is a Physician Assistant with extensive experience in the healthcare field, currently working at Eventus WholeHealth since 2020. He has previously held positions at Doctors Making Housecalls and UNC Hospitals, and served as a U.S. Army Aviation Officer for over a decade.
